Understanding Watermelon Allergies in Labradors

Labradors are beloved companions known for their friendly nature and playful personalities. As responsible pet owners, it’s important for us to be aware of any potential allergies that our furry friends may have, including allergies to certain foods. One common question that arises is whether dogs, specifically Labradors, can be allergic to watermelon.

  1. Watermelon Allergies – A Rare Occurrence: While dogs can develop allergies to various substances, such as pollen or certain proteins, watermelon allergies in Labradors are quite rare. This means that the chances of your Labrador being allergic to watermelon are relatively low.
  2. Allergic Reactions – Individual Variations: Just like humans, dogs can have individual variations when it comes to allergic reactions. While some Labradors may show no adverse effects after consuming a small amount of watermelon, others may experience symptoms of an allergy.
  3. Symptoms of Watermelon Allergy: If your Labrador is indeed allergic to watermelon, you might observe symptoms such as:
    • Itchy skin
    • Redness or inflammation
    • Hives or rashes
    • Vomiting or diarrhoea
    • Difficulty breathing
  1. Consulting a Veterinarian: If you suspect that your Labrador may have an allergy to watermelon or any other food item, it’s essential to consult with a veterinarian. They can conduct tests and provide guidance tailored specifically for your dog’s needs.
  2. Safe Alternatives: If you discover that your Labrador is indeed allergic to watermelon but still want them to enjoy delicious treats during hot summer months, there are plenty of safe alternatives available! Consider offering them other fruits like apples or bananas which are generally well-tolerated by dogs.

Remember, each dog is unique and may react differently even if they belong to the same breed. It’s always best to monitor your Labrador closely when introducing new foods and consult with a professional if you have any concerns about potential allergies.

In conclusion, while watermelon allergies in Labradors are rare, it’s important to be aware of the possibility. By understanding the symptoms and consulting a veterinarian, you can ensure the well-being of your furry friend and provide them with suitable alternatives if needed.
